Different Services Offered by PTSD Rehab in Plato

DetoxificationDetoxification is often the first step in treating PTSD and addiction at rehab centers. This process safely manages withdrawal symptoms as the body clears itself of toxins. Detox is crucial because many individuals with PTSD may turn to substances as a coping mechanism for their unresolved trauma. By undergoing detox in a controlled environment, patients receive medical supervision, which significantly reduces the risks associated with withdrawal. Detox prepares individuals for the subsequent treatment phases, allowing them to approach therapy with a clearer mind and a stronger determination to heal. Facilities in Plato ensure that the detoxification process is as comfortable and supportive as possible, setting the stage for further recovery efforts.
Inpatient TreatmentInpatient treatment at PTSD rehab centers in Plato involves intensive, structured care within a residential setting. Patients reside at the facility, providing them with a secure environment focused solely on recovery. This immersion allows for around-the-clock support from mental health professionals, fostering a community of individuals who share similar struggles. Inpatient programs use a combination of individual and group therapies, which are essential for addressing the multifaceted nature of PTSD. The communal aspect of this treatment enhances the healing process, allowing patients to learn from each other's experiences. By eliminating outside distractions, inpatient care promotes personal growth and stability, leading to enhanced outcomes.
Outpatient TreatmentOutpatient treatment provides flexibility for individuals who may not be able to commit to inpatient care due to work, school, or family obligations. Programs typically involve regular counseling sessions, therapy, and support groups while allowing patients to continue their daily activities. This approach is particularly beneficial for those who may have already completed an inpatient program or have less severe symptoms of PTSD. It fosters gradual reintegration into society while still offering structure and accountability, ensuring patients have the tools and support necessary to maintain their recovery outside the rehab environment.
Therapy and CounselingTherapy and counseling are cornerstones of PTSD treatment in rehab centers. A variety of therapeutic modalities are available, such as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R), and trauma-focused therapy. These evidence-based approaches are pivotal for helping patients understand their trauma responses, develop coping strategies, and process their emotions. Individual therapy allows for deep personal exploration, while group therapy creates a supportive network and encourages the sharing of experiences, which can help reduce feelings of isolation. Patients learn to develop healthier thinking patterns and reframe their traumatic memories, promoting long-term recovery.
Partial Hospitalization ProgramsPartial hospitalization programs (PHP) provide an intensive outpatient treatment option for those requiring more support than traditional outpatient care offers. Patients participate in a structured daily schedule that includes therapeutic activities, counseling, and skills training, without the overnight stay required in residential treatment. This program strikes a balance between inpatient and outpatient care, allowing individuals to live at home while receiving comprehensive treatment. It is especially effective for those transitioning from inpatient settings or needing stabilization before further outpatient treatment. PHPs aim to build resilience and coping mechanisms to manage PTSD symptoms effectively.
Aftercare ServicesAftercare services are integral to a successful long-term recovery from PTSD and addiction. These programs provide continued support following the completion of primary treatment. They often include ongoing therapy, support group meetings, and resource connections to community services. Aftercare is crucial as it helps individuals reintegrate into daily life without the crutch of substances and with guidance on managing triggers associated with their PTSD. This stage emphasizes the importance of maintaining connections with peers and professionals, allowing patients to share their ongoing challenges and successes, ultimately contributing to sustained sobriety and improved mental health.
Cost of PTSD Rehab in Plato
Insurance CoverageMany rehab centers for PTSD in Plato accept various health insurance plans, which can significantly offset treatment costs. It is essential to verify the specifics of each plan, as some may cover inpatient or outpatient services, therapy sessions, and medications while others may exclude certain aspects. Individuals are encouraged to consult with their insurance provider and the rehab center's admissions team to understand coverage details, co-pays, and any out-of-pocket expenses. Leveraging health insurance not only eases the financial burden but also encourages individuals to seek the specialized care they desperately need.
Payment PlansRehab centers often offer flexible payment plans designed to accommodate the financial situations of their patients. These plans can include sliding scales based on income or installment payments that spread the cost of treatment over time. Financial advisors at the centers can assist patients in creating a manageable payment structure that allows them to access necessary services while maintaining financial stability. Such arrangements demonstrate the commitment of these facilities to support patients through their recovery journey without the added stress of financial strain, increasing the likelihood of successful treatment.
Government GrantsGovernment grants can provide significant financial assistance for those seeking treatment for PTSD at rehab centers. These grants are often offered through local and state programs aimed at improving mental health services accessibility. Eligibility for such grants usually depends on financial need and location. Applicants may be required to provide documentation or complete specific criteria, but receiving these funds can substantially reduce out-of-pocket costs. Engaging with counselors knowledgeable about available grants can facilitate the application process, making it easier for individuals to gain the support they require.
Financial Assistance ProgramsMany rehab centers for PTSD in Plato establish financial assistance programs to help individuals who may lack sufficient resources for treatment. These programs can include funding from charitable organizations, sliding-scale fees, or community donations aimed at supporting those in need. Facilities are often dedicated to lowering barriers to care, as they recognize that financial hardships should not stand in the way of obtaining critical mental health treatment. Prospective patients are encouraged to inquire about available options during the admissions process to determine their eligibility for assistance.
Self-Pay OptionsSelf-pay options for rehab treatment provide an alternative for those who prefer not to use insurance or who have plans that do not cover the required services. Choosing to self-pay can have benefits, including stipulating the choice of treatment methods and facilities. However, attention should be given to the overall cost of treatment options, as this can substantially vary. Rehab centers typically offer transparent pricing and detailed breakdowns of each service provided, allowing patients to make informed choices regarding their care. Those opting for self-pay are encouraged to discuss potential discounts or financial arrangements with the rehabilitation facility.
Scholarships and Financial AidScholarships and financial aid programs specific to mental health and addiction treatment can also play a pivotal role in enabling access to services at rehab centers for PTSD in Plato. These scholarships often originate from non-profit organizations, community trusts, or the rehab centers themselves. They are designed to support individuals who demonstrate financial need but are committed to their recovery. Application processes typically require a personal statement outlining the need for assistance, along with information about background and treatment aspirations. By opening doors to essential recovery resources, scholarships can empower patients to prioritize their health and seek the help they deserve.
